  1. Is there a new 5 disease medical form other than the short very basic one?
     

    I just went to a local clinic, told them it was for driving license, they gave me the basic health check, weight, height, blood pressure, counted my limbs etc, 100 baht.
    Worked fine in Ayutthaya DLT.

    The 5 disease med cert is for an OA visa, maybe other things also but I don’t believe it’s required for a DL.
